Case registered, tempo seized for overloading in Poonch
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terWhatsappTelegramEmail

Poonch, Jan 31: Authorities in Surankote Poonch on Wednesday filed a case against the tempo driver for allegedly indulging in stunt driving and overloading.

According to the INS, a case under FOR number 0019 under section 279,336 IPC has been registered against a tempo driver who was carrying 23 passengers in tempo which is against the permit conditions and also registration certificate norms.

Only 13 to 14 passengers are allowed in tempo.

The vehicle was later seized by local police on the spot and also two vehicles have been blacklisted due to stunt and dangerous driving, pictures of whose also went viral on the social media platform.

Traffic Rural Rajouri-Poonch Police have appealed people not to indulge in stunt driving and overloading of passengers.

Pertinently, the special in this regard was launched by SO ASI Mahroof and DTI Poonch Insp. Kapil Manhas under the supervision of Dysp Nawaz Choudhary along with MVD Poonch.
